What they do

A Nuclear Medicine Technologist performs procedures that use radioactive materials to diagnose and treat illnesses. Works under the supervision of a physician, including physicians that specialize in nuclear medicine, in hospitals or other healthcare facilities.

$98,690 / year median in California

+15% projected growth

Desired Experience & Skills:
ARRT(N) or CNMT certification required. Valid state licensure (if applicable). Minimum of one year of recent experience in nuclear medicine imaging. Comprehensive understanding of imaging equipment, radiation safety, and quality assurance standards. Excellent communication and patient care abilities. Proficiency in performing, processing, and interpreting nuclear medicine studies.
Key Responsibilities:
Operate nuclear medicine imaging equipment to produce high-quality diagnostic images. Prepare and administer radiopharmaceuticals according to strict safety protocols. Collaborate with physicians to ensure accurate patient assessments and diagnoses. Maintain meticulous patient records and adhere to established regulatory requirements. Provide compassionate support and instruction to patients throughout procedures.
